4. Experience Bali’s Nightlife at Kuta’s Clubs

Kuta is renowned for its vibrant nightlife, making it one of the top fun things to do in Kuta. The clubs at Kuta attract visitors with pulsating beats and lively atmospheres. Popular spots such as Sky Garden and Engine Room host international DJs and themed parties that will keep you dancing until dawn.
Moreover, if you’re not sure where to start, many clubs offer exciting drink specials that make it easy to enjoy a night out without breaking the bank.
Insider Tip: Arrive early to take advantage of free entry and happy hour deals!
5. Visit the Waterbom Bali Water Park
If you’re searching for thrilling outdoor activities in Kuta, look no further than Waterbom Bali Water Park. This award-winning water park offers a variety of slides and attractions for all ages. From the adrenaline-pumping “Climax” slide to relaxing lazy rivers, it’s guaranteed fun for the entire family.
Add to your experience by enjoying a meal at one of the park’s several restaurants. An entire day can be easily spent here, so make sure to wear sunscreen and bring plenty of water for hydration.
Pro Tip: Try to visit on a weekday to avoid the large crowds!

16. Take a Guided Tour of the Bali Bomb Memorial
A visit to the Bali Bomb Memorial is a somber yet essential experience for travelers in Kuta and Legian. This significant site commemorates the lives lost in the tragic 2002 bombings. Join a guided tour to learn about the history and the stories behind this monumental memorial.
While the atmosphere is reflective, insight into Indonesia’s resilience post-tragedy is enlightening. Be respectful while exploring this site, as it serves as a tribute to the victims. It’s one of the profound places to visit in Kuta that offers an important reminder of peace.
17. Visit the Bali Sea Turtle Society
The Bali Sea Turtle Society offers a unique opportunity to learn about the conservation of these majestic creatures while enjoying fun activities. Located just a short drive from Kuta, this organization focuses on protecting sea turtles and educating the public on their importance.
Join a program to witness the release of baby turtles into the ocean, creating lasting memories and contributing to conservation efforts. This experience is particularly memorable for families and children! Be sure to check their schedule for release times.
